Output 866468927e13b43c8a0d0406362c5dd1058aebbd109f681f225efb68c9888fbd:0

value
608259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a61b992a13faadd1ef3a1ec6cd133185c5e70bf8 OP_EQUAL
address
3GqK9x7NfqvWG5bkBRRveCH8avwUzgti7N
transaction
866468927e13b43c8a0d0406362c5dd1058aebbd109f681f225efb68c9888fbd
spent
true